Entertainment: Contrary to rumors of a star-studded spectacle, Gautam Adani clarified that his son's wedding would be a simple and traditional family affair . The ceremony, held in Ahmedabad on February 7, 2025, reflects the family's values and upbringing. The pre-wedding festivities took place at Shantivan, the Adani family's residence, with the wedding ceremony at Shantigram, the Adani township in Ahmedabad.

Artisanal Touches and Cultural Heritage

The wedding showcases India's rich artistic traditions, incorporating handmade items from across the country.The wedding celebrates Indian artisans, incorporating elements that add a cultural and personal touch. Guests can expect Paithani sarees from Nashik artisans, mudwork murals by Nitaben from Mundra, and traditional bangles from Bibaji Choori Wala in Jodhpur. Stunning glass art pieces made by Munna and Nazmeen, the father-daughter duo from Firozabad, is one of the beautiful decorations that can be seen in the celebration.

Fashion Meets Social Impact

A collaboration with NGOs brings social responsibility to the forefront of the wedding festivities. Jeet Adani and Diva Shah are intertwining their wedding with causes close to their hearts. Manish Malhotra collaborated with the NGO Family of Disabled (FOD) to create custom shawls for the couple, blending fashion with social impact. The NGO is also crafting hand-painted wedding essentials, including glassware, plates, and accessories. The couple visited Mitti Cafe, an NGO creating employment for people with disabilities, extending their wedding invitation and spending time with them.

A Pledge to Empowerment

The couple's commitment to social causes extends beyond the wedding day, promising ongoing supportJeet and Diva have pledged to "Mangal Seva," providing financial assistance of ₹10 lakh each to 500 newly married women with disabilities, a gesture that Gautam Adani calls a matter of immense satisfaction and good fortune. This commitment highlights the couple's dedication to making a difference in the lives of others.
